在安装 Handbrake 后,部分用户可能会遇到“缺少 .NET Framework”或“.NET Framework 未正确安装”的提示。该问题通常出现在 Windows 系统中,原因可能是系统未安装或未启用所需的 .NET Framework 版本(Handbrake 通常需要 .NET Framework 4.7.2 或更高版本)。此外,系统更新未完成、安装文件损坏或兼容性问题也可能导致此错误。解决方法包括:检查 Windows Update 并安装最新更新、手动下载安装最新版 .NET Framework、通过“启用或关闭 Windows 功能”启用 .NET Framework、或使用系统文件检查工具 sfc /scannow 修复系统文件。
1条回答 默认 最新
请闭眼沉思 2025-09-02 04:25关注安装 Handbrake 时提示“缺少 .NET Framework”或“.NET Framework 未正确安装”的深度解析与解决方案
1. 问题现象概述
在安装或运行 Handbrake 时,部分用户可能会遇到以下提示信息:
- “缺少 .NET Framework”
- “.NET Framework 未正确安装”
此类问题多出现在 Windows 系统上,尤其在较旧版本的 Windows(如 Windows 7、Windows 8)中更为常见。
2. 问题原因分析
Handbrake 依赖 .NET Framework 运行时环境,通常要求至少 .NET Framework 4.7.2 或更高版本。问题可能由以下几个方面引起:
可能原因 说明 .NET Framework 未安装或版本过低 系统中未安装所需的 .NET Framework 版本,或安装的版本低于 Handbrake 所需最低版本。 系统更新未完成 Windows 更新未完成,导致 .NET Framework 组件未正确更新。 安装文件损坏或不完整 下载的 Handbrake 安装包或系统组件文件损坏。 兼容性问题 系统设置或安全策略阻止了 .NET Framework 的正常加载。 系统文件损坏 Windows 系统关键文件损坏导致 .NET Framework 无法正常工作。 3. 解决方案流程图
graph TD A[开始] --> B[检查当前 .NET Framework 版本] B --> C{是否已安装 4.7.2 或更高版本?} C -->|是| D[尝试重新安装 Handbrake] C -->|否| E[手动安装最新 .NET Framework] E --> F[启用 Windows 功能中的 .NET Framework] F --> G[运行 Windows Update] G --> H[运行 sfc /scannow 扫描系统文件] H --> I[完成排查]4. 具体解决步骤
- 检查当前 .NET Framework 版本:
- 打开“控制面板” → “程序” → “启用或关闭 Windows 功能”
- 查看“.NET Framework 4.8 高级服务”是否勾选
- 手动下载并安装 .NET Framework:
- 访问微软官网:.NET Framework 下载页面
- 下载并安装 .NET Framework 4.8(推荐版本)
- 启用 Windows 功能中的 .NET Framework:
- 打开“控制面板” → “程序” → “启用或关闭 Windows 功能”
- 勾选“.NET Framework 4.8 高级服务”并确认安装
- 运行 Windows Update 更新系统:
- 打开“设置” → “更新与安全” → “Windows 更新”
- 检查并安装所有可用更新,确保系统组件完整
- 运行系统文件检查工具:
sfc /scannow该命令会扫描并修复系统文件,可能解决因系统文件损坏导致的 .NET Framework 问题。
- 尝试修复或重新安装 Handbrake:
- 卸载当前安装的 Handbrake
- 从官网重新下载安装包进行安装
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报